Linus Ullmark can set Boston Bruins franchise history his next game

With a 5-2 win over the New York Rangers on Thursday night, Linus Ullmark tied Tim Thomas for a franchise record by a goaltender.
As per NHL Stats:
Linus Ullmark became the second goaltender in franchise history to earn wins during each of his first eight decisions in a season, joining Tim Thomas (8-0-0 in 2010-11). The longest such run in NHL history is 12, achieved by Ray Emery with Chicago in 2012-13.
The 29-year-old is 8-0-0 to start this season with a 2.19 goals-against-average and a .932 save percentage. Besides one shaky outing against the Pittsburgh Penguins recently, where he got pulled and came back in, Ullmark has been incredible so far.
Ullmark will likely start again on Saturday when the Bruins visit the Toronto Maple Leafs. Jim Montgomery is leaning that way with Jeremy Swayman injured and facing a solid Maple Leafs team.
